Output ede7693d25b1d3211b477e1612f0a0fb960cc7f56c702960f818c8a1f7f85205:3

value
29000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99481c4c1a731ce5bdf9d568a4a4a1218914b0e5 OP_EQUAL
address
3FfVhDp4coQq2Um5L3NY2atnK7LHWRe7hm
transaction
ede7693d25b1d3211b477e1612f0a0fb960cc7f56c702960f818c8a1f7f85205
spent
true